Abstract
The present invention relates to a process for treating gases to reduce emissions of oxides of nitrogen. This process is of the type in which a catalytic composition is used which comprises a catalytic phase on a support and is characterized in that the support is based on silica and titanium oxide in an atomic proportion Ti/Ti+Si of between 0.1 and 15%. The process of the invention applies more particularly to the treatment of the exhaust gases from diesel engines or from lean burn engines.
